- TitleReads- Duchess and work at Froxfield cottage. Ready to meet Swanborough. Glad you proposed South coming to Willington; the old miller being now dead, it is proper to have his advice on state of mill. Palmer's s. has applied to have mill again; told him prob, fresh tenant, must leave at Michaelmas. When South is there, his opinion desirable on damage done by Navigation people. The other tenants, Brimley & Clayton, will have a similar claim, as John Purser, as regards their meadows, though their meadows are smaller. Hing (?) discharged gamekeeper ; White has applied for field adjacent house at Birchmoor.
